Comfort Keepers of Madison spotlights VA home care for Sun Prairie families
Comfort Keepers of Madison is highlighting VA home care assistance for veterans and seniors in Sun Prairie, Wisconsin, as families look for support that helps loved ones stay at home. The company says the right care can ease pressure on adult children while preserving independence and routine for aging veterans.
Why it matters: - VA home care can help a Veteran remain at home with dignity while easing the burden on family caregivers. - Support can reduce stress for adult children who are balancing work, parenting and care decisions at the same time. - For Sun Prairie families, local in-home help may be the difference between staying in a familiar setting and moving to a more institutional care arrangement.
What happened: - Comfort Keepers of Madison shared information for Sun Prairie families exploring VA home care assistance. - The company used the story of Daniel and his father Frank, a Veteran recovering from a hospital stay, to illustrate how in-home support can help families manage daily care. - Comfort Keepers of Madison said it has been family-owned and operated for 24 years and serves Sun Prairie, Madison, Middleton and nearby communities.
The details: - Available support can include companionship, personal care, meal preparation, transportation, respite, mobility help around the home and other in-home assistance. - Some families may only need a few hours of help each week, while others may need 24-hour care as circumstances change. - Comfort Keepers of Madison says the goal is to support both independence and peace of mind for Veterans and their families. - The company also highlighted ongoing team training, professional development, support and growth opportunities as part of its care model. - Comfort Keepers of Madison says it has Best of Home Care recognition in the Madison area. - Families can request a care assessment and contact the local office for more information.
